A Harsh Message from Trump to Iran: Tensions Are Rising!

U.S. President Donald Trump delivered a comprehensive speech before Congress, making striking statements about Iran’s nuclear program, the war in Ukraine, and the U.S. economy. The address, which lasted approximately 1 hour and 48 minutes and became one of the longest presidential speeches to the nation in American history, focused heavily on foreign policy and national security issues. A significant portion of Trump’s speech was devoted to Iran’s nuclear activities. He emphasized that Washington would make no concessions on the issue. Delivering firm messages regarding Iran’s nuclear capabilities, the U.S. President discussed possible scenarios and diplomatic processes, reopening debate on the global security agenda.

Trump: “We Will Not Allow Iran to Obtain Nuclear Weapons”

Speaking before members of Congress, Trump claimed that Iran’s nuclear capacity had previously been dismantled but alleged that Tehran intends to restart the program. He stated that all options remain on the table regarding Iran, stressing diplomacy as his preferred route while not ruling out military action.

In his speech, Trump said:

“Right now, all options are on the table… I will never allow Iran to obtain nuclear weapons. We completely destroyed Iran’s nuclear weapons program. But they want to restart it. My primary preference is diplomacy… But the world’s number one state sponsor of terrorism cannot possess nuclear weapons.”

Trump also claimed that Iran has been developing missile capabilities capable of reaching the United States and stated that Washington would take a firm stance on this matter. The former president also addressed the Russia-Ukraine war, which has been ongoing since 2022. Emphasizing efforts to end the conflict, Trump drew attention to the high monthly casualties. He said, “We are working very hard to end the war in Ukraine. Twenty-five thousand soldiers are dying every month. If I had been president at that time, this war would not have happened,” criticizing the current administration’s policies.

Emphasis on the Economy and Tariffs

Trump also evaluated the U.S. economy in his remarks. He argued that import tariffs have made a significant contribution to economic recovery, revitalized domestic production, and strengthened American industry. He described tariffs as a crucial tool for reducing the trade deficit and protecting the domestic market. Calling the Supreme Court’s decision to cancel certain tariffs “unfortunate,” Trump stressed that trade policy plays a vital role in economic growth. He stated:

“Tariffs brought our economy back to life. America’s golden age has begun. Modern income tax will, to a large extent, be replaced by tariffs.”

These remarks signaled a continued commitment to protectionist trade policies and were interpreted as an indication that more aggressive steps could be taken in U.S. trade and tax policy in the near future.

Assessment

Trump’s speech before Congress signaled that the United States intends to maintain a firm stance on global security issues, particularly regarding Iran’s nuclear program and the war in Ukraine. His message that “all options are on the table” concerning Iran has raised concerns about increasing geopolitical risks. Meanwhile, tariffs and trade policies remain central priorities in his economic approach moving forward.
